Air Canada announces non-stop flights between Halifax, Brussels

Haligonians will soon be able to fly directly to another European destination as Air Canada announces non-stop service to Brussels, Belgium.

The airline says the route, connecting Halifax Stanfield and Brussels Airport, will launch on June 18, 2026.

The seasonal service will run three times a week using a “narrowbody” aircraft, according to Air Canada.

“This exciting new route is a significant milestone for Halifax Stanfield and for our region,” said Joyce Carter, President & CEO, HIAA. “Air Canada’s continued investment in our market strengthens Halifax’s position as an international gateway and creates new possibilities for business, tourism, and exploring the world.”

The route is Air Canada’s second international destination from Halifax, the other being a daily direct service to London Heathrow.

Haligonians also have several overseas options through West Jet, which offers direct seasonal flights to Barcelona, Paris, Amsterdam, Dublin, Edinburgh, London, and the recently added Copenhagen, Madrid and Lisbon.

Other European destinations from Halifax include Zurich with Edelweiss, Frankfurt on Discover, and Reykjavik via Icelandair.
